Recently I was looking at the new Madden 07 for Xbox 360. Well I was quickly informed that I would probably not want to mess with it… and here is the reason why.
EA’s new Privacy Policy anonymously creates an online account to track you, but oh it gets better… with your “anonymous” account you also give up your ip address which can simply be linked to a database of information, that would have search history, purchases and even credit card information. In a nutshell it basically comes down to how important is the game and is it worth your privacy?
